    but when I select both objects and click the align vertical that they align themselves with an invisible horizontal line

    It's (almost) identical to:

    Because (the centers of) lined up beside the objects will be on the same horizontal level/line.

    And it's just a way to express what vertical alignment means. Here are some others:

    Their centres are the same height,

    Their centers have the same value of Y on the Board/chart workspace.

    In all cases, you can draw a horizontal line through their centers.

    Mathematically, Y = C (there is a C constant value) is the equation of a horizontal line.

    With Find\Change you can:

    Find/replace > object tab

    Tye: Blocks of text

    Change object Format: click on specify the attributes to modify > text frame general Options > vertical Justification > Align > Top

    Then find and change or change all

    By default, the content of the table cell is average aligned.  You need not do anything.

    If you want your cell vertically aligned up or down, you can specify it in your CSS.  These effects all the text inside the cell.   It's all or nothing.
